Output 75ec17235cef0a2d831d6818bdc4254d89994f6e3a6bd85f7a5ddc715736816f:194

value
141366
script pubkey
OP_0 OP_PUSHBYTES_32 dcf89b4b4621099a7217a5060bfb4ab81cf2063a37413c0f8ba1d3aa448bc8cc
address
bc1qmnufkj6xyyye5ush55rqh762hqw0yp36xaqncrut58f653yterxqua2u50
transaction
75ec17235cef0a2d831d6818bdc4254d89994f6e3a6bd85f7a5ddc715736816f